WebIf you are uploading or downloading videos to or from YouTube in the UK, then UK copyright laws apply. YouTube is a platform for video sharing online and it is the users who are responsible for complying with the laws of copyright. If you upload a video that is infringing someone’s copyright, the owner of that copyright can inform YouTube ... Under the law of the United Kingdom, a copyright is an intangible property right subsisting in certain qualifying subject matter. Copyright law is governed by the Copyright, Designs and Patents Act 1988 (the 1988 Act), as amended from time to time.
